When Lai Mohammed was ‘famzing’, Femi Adesina was jubilant and Garba Shehu was grieving over receiving or missing of President’s call from London in February, Mr Sharada was in regular contact with the Nigerian leader on phone.ĭAILY NIGERIAN reliably gathered that Mr Sharada also calls the president to brief him on the state of the nation.Īt a prayer session for President Buhari’s recovery organised by Kano State government on February 22, Mr Sharada picked his phone midway into the live TV prayer session and called the president to inform him about the gathering. Pompous and flamboyant, Mr Sharada at every opportunity would demonstrate to his friends or top government officials his closeness to the president by calling him on phone in their presence. Talk about access to the president in his residence or in office, Mr Sha’aban enjoyed that privilege even before his appointment. Mr Sharada warmed himself into Mr Buhari’s heart for his regular visits to cover events and recording of Mr Buhari’s statements. Sha’aban Sharada with the president during last year’s Sallah festivalįor chieftains of the defunct Congress for Progressive Change, CPC, President Buhari’s Yar’Adua Close residence in Kaduna was political sanctuary where politicians gathered, like pilgrims, for anointing. While there, he made contacts with politicians, especially President Buhari’s ally, Jafaru Isa. He was later redeployed to the religion desk of the station, where he became famous for coverage of religious events such as Maulud and preaching.Īfter a couple of years at the religion desk, he was later redeployed to the programme department, where he produced sponsored programmes. Mr Sharada, a graduate of Mass Communication from Bayero University, Kano, began his journalism career as a marketing assistant with Freedom Radio, Kano. Backed by the powerful cabal led by the president’s powerful nephew Mamman Daura, Mr Sharada commands respect from governors, ministers and other top government officials.
